不采用MATLAB函数,实现对一幅真彩色图像的高斯滤波。
clc;clear;close all;
I=imread(‘hua.jpg’);
[N,M,C]=size(I);
subplot(1,3,1);
imshow(I),title(‘原图’);
NoiseI=imnoise(I,‘gaussian’);%添加高斯噪声
subplot(1,3,2);
imshow(NoiseI),title(‘添加高斯噪声后’);
sigma=10;
r=3;
Newr=2r+1;%取奇数
H=zeros(Newr,Newr);
sum=0;
for i=1:Newr
fo
原创
2021-03-31 12:00:20 ·
417 阅读 ·
0 评论